ACCA and IIM Nagpur join forces to foster excellence in the accountancy profession

Bengaluru, July 14, 2025: ACCA (the Association of Chartered Certified Accountants), a globally recognised professional accountancy body, and the prestigious management institution, the Indian Institute of Management Nagpur (IIM Nagpur), today announced the signing of a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) to enhance educational opportunities in the field of accounting and finance. The signing was officiated by Prabhanshu Mittal, ACCA's Head of Educational Partner Relationships - India and Prof. Bhimaraya Metri, Director at IIM Nagpur.
 
This collaboration aims to enrich educational opportunities in the field of accountancy by providing students with a globally recognised qualification and fostering excellence in academic and professional development. ACCA, a distinguished global professional accountancy body, and IIM Nagpur, renowned for its academic excellence, are set to transform the learning experience for aspiring finance professionals.
 
As a part of this MoU, both bodies will collaborate to facilitate academic collaboration through joint academic programs, workshops, and seminars. Additionally, ACCA will also implement joint initiatives for professional development, including train the trainer and faculty development sessions. Furthermore, ACCA will work together with the institute to cultivate a culture of innovation and research in the field of accounting and finance, contributing to the advancements in the profession.
